Laravel Reverb Documentation

Laravel Reverb, a first-party WebSocket server for Laravel applications, launched with Laravel 11 as well. The full documentation for getting started with Reverb is now available in the official documentation. It will walk you through installing, setting up, and running the Reverb server in production.

Upgrade to Laravel 11 with Shift

You can automate the Upgrade of Laravel 10.x to Laravel 11.x with Laravel Shift. This is an amazing way to speed up the upgrade process and get those existing Laravel applications running on the latest version of Laravel.

Laravel News creator Eric Barnes demonstrates upgrading laravel-news.com to Laravel 11 using the amazing Shift service:

The Laravel 11 shift includes streamlining your configuration files to their true customizations, consolidating service providers, getting your app to reflect the Laravel 11 application structure updates, and more.

Laravel 11 Documentation Prologue

Each Laravel release contains a Prologue section, which contains Release Notes, an Upgrade Guide, and a Contribution Guide. Using Laravel Shift is the best way to upgrade, but reading through the release notes and upgrade guide is an excellent way to familiarize yourself with changes to the latest Laravel version.

A quick way to stay current with Laravel releases is the laravelversions.com website (and their APIs) so that you always know where to go to find dates for release, end of bug fixes, and end of security updates for Laravel & PHP.
